Google Chrome扩展程序,新标签焦点

时间:2014-06-04 23:44:51

标签: javascript google-chrome google-chrome-extension tabs jquery-tabs

我一直致力于谷歌Chrome的扩展,这是我的第一次尝试。 到目前为止,我已经能够在新选项卡中运行我的扩展,但我想知道是否有可能将焦点从omnibar / addressbar移除到选项卡式窗口中的某些内容。

例如,我正在实现输入字段或文本区域,当新选项卡打开时,我希望闪烁的光标/插入符号来自所述文本区域,而不是google omnibar。

使用jquery或任何谷歌浏览器扩展API的任何可能性?

1 个答案:

答案 0 :(得分:1)

我有同样的问题。我的解决方案是使用“虚拟html”文件作为新页面,并且该页面所做的所有操作都运行以下JavaScript代码(在与虚拟html文件链接的外部JS文件中):

window.open("the-real-new-tab-page.html")
window.close()